Blame Canada for PLG. He grew up in Montreal, got his first skateboard at eight years old, and according to legend, had a skatepark and ramp in his backyard. Since turning pro in 1996, Pierre-Luc Gagnon has evolved into one of the most influential and dominating vert skaters from the 20th Century into the 21st. He’s won everything from Canadian Championships to the X Games and if skateboarding ever follows snowboarding into the Olympics, he’ll probably win medals there too. PLG is most often described as a technical skater and his 540 nollie heel flip is considered one of the highest technologies of ramp skating. That being said, PLG also has style. He makes this look good and now he’s added not only another title to his resume, Maloof Money Cup Vert Champion, but took home the biggest prize in the history of the sport with a sweet $75,000 check and a new Ford. He’s the present – and future – of the sport.
